I think there was some hope that the coax directivity would be super clean ala KEF and it's not *quite* there, IMO the slightly decreasing directivity from 1-6 KHz might make things a touch bright / shouty in room compared to the Kii stuff.
I don't think this speaker is a no-brainer for all nearfield setups but if someone is space constrained, listens at a desk, and doesn't want to add subs or treatment to the room, I think the directivity error could be an easy trade-off to get the bass and cardioid functionality.
By the looks of it, it may still be quite dynamically constrained at least in the far field. And in the near field, there's the self noise. And in any case there's the uneven directivity. Not nearly as smooth as a lot of other designs.

When did the Kii 7 become the reference standard? It's not like that's a beloved or hyped monitor. It's got shortcomings too.Kii 7 is cardioid down to 150Hz while Palmer stops at about 250Hz.
So Palmer needs to go closer to the rear wall to avoid a notch due to wall reflection.
Less low-frequency extension of cardiod cancellation means lower distortion for Palmer.
Horizontal dispersion contour is slightly better for Kii but vertical much better for Palmer.
Overall, Palmer radiation pattern seems on-par with Kii 7.
For best performance any speaker requires some room EQ.
